VA Plans Reno Hospital Move with Big Environmental Study

The VA plans to move the Ioannis A. Lougaris VA Medical Center in Reno, Nevada, and wants to check how this big change might affect the environment. This move will impact veterans, local communities, and the environment, with detailed studies coming soon to guide smart decisions. The process will take time and careful planning to make sure everything runs smoothly and responsibly.
